When many people listen to a light diet, they will think of the phrase "fish makes a fire, meat produces phlegm, and cabbage tofu keeps them safe". It seems that they will eat rice porridge, side dishes and tofu noodles for three meals a day, and even many people will think that a light diet is vegetarian.
However, according to clinical observation, the extreme practice of not eating meat and oil and salt is not only not conducive to the recovery of the disease, but also leads to the decline of physical fitness. Not only is the curative effect of traditional Chinese medicine greatly reduced, but old diseases are difficult to heal, and it is more vulnerable to various new diseases.
Light is relative to "fat, sweet and thick", which does not mean that you don't eat meat at all. The real light diet is to reasonably match nutrition on the basis of food diversification, limit animal food, cooking oil and salt within a reasonable range, and avoid excessive use of spicy and aromatic condiments.
A scientific and reasonable light diet itself is a good way to maintain good physique and recuperate diseases. Especially for patients with hyperlipidemia, obesity, spleen and stomach diseases, c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ases, surgery, cancer radiotherapy and chemotherapy, we should pay more attention to light diet.
The core concept of cooking is to keep the original flavor of food as much as possible, with light and peaceful taste, rich nutrition and easy digestion and absorption.
Peanut oil, rapeseed oil, olive oil, sunflower oil, soybean oil, lard, butter, etc. , should be eaten regularly, mainly vegetable oil, supplemented by a small amount of animal oil, 20-30 grams of edible oil per person per day is appropriate.
When cooking, control the oil temperature at 150- 180. When you put oil in the pot, you can put a small piece of shredded onion. When there are many small bubbles around the shredded onion, the dishes can be served.
It's a little late after the dishes are smoked. At that time, when the oil temperature exceeds 200, the oil will decompose and produce many harmful substances.
Fat meat is high in fat content, which is easy to cause or aggravate c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ases for obese people, and can be supplemented appropriately for children or the elderly with thin body and dry skin. You can choose pork belly, beef brisket and so on. If you are peaceful.
Compared with livestock meat, white meat such as fish meat and poultry meat has relatively low fat content and high unsaturated fatty acid content, which has a good effect on preventing hyperlipidemia and cardiovascular and cerebrovascular diseases.
It is suggested that the daily salt intake of adults should not exceed 6 grams. When cooking or cooking soup, you can add salt when the dish is about to come out of the pot, which not only ensures the taste but also reduces the dosage.
In addition to salt, fresh products such as monosodium glutamate, chicken essence and mushroom essence, as well as salty condiments such as soy sauce and bean paste also contain a lot of sodium, so eat less.
Eating spicy food properly can increase appetite and accelerate absorption, but too spicy can easily stimulate the digestive system, damage the gastrointestinal mucosa, form gastrointestinal inflammation or polyps, and oral ulcers and constipation are more common.
Eat less high-sugar food. It is suggested that the daily sugar intake should be controlled below 50g, depending on age, constitution and illness.
The added sugar includes white sugar, rock sugar, brown sugar, maltose, etc. , including fructose, glucose, fructose syrup, etc. In desserts and sweet juices. Excessive intake will excessively stimulate the body's insulin secretion, accelerate fat synthesis, endanger health, or aggravate diseases.
By means of quick frying, stewing, steaming and boiling, the original flavor and nutrition of food are preserved to the maximum extent.
We must also learn how to mix various ingredients. Many ingredients in traditional cooking have a fixed collocation, which has the function of complementing each other with traditional Chinese medicine.
Such as fried pork slices with bamboo shoots, konjac bacon, melon balls, Chinese cabbage pork vermicelli, stewed pork ribs with lotus root, tomato brisket and so on. It has a wonderful combination of meat, cold, heat, taste and food properties. It is not only delicious, but also easy to absorb and rich in nutrition.
